Case Study
Richmond Fourplex with Laneway Suite
Address-first feasibility led to a phased preconstruction program and GMP alignment for a fourplex plus laneway suite in Richmond.
Richmond, BC Fourplex + Laneway Suite
Estimated Profit
$1.05M – $1.28M
Hard Cost Band
$1.72M – $1.88M
Projected Sale Price
$1.29M / unit
Summary
- Free plan surfaced servicing upgrades and frontage constraints before design spend.
- Permit-readiness checklist coordinated architect, structural, and survey milestones.
- Builder GMP locked within 2% of budget band prior to permit submission.

Timeline Snapshot
Feasibility + Plan
36 hours
Design + Readiness
9 weeks
Construction
15 months
Next Steps
- Issue tender set to trade partners two months before permit issuance.
- Coordinate laneway suite finish selections with brokerage to align with buyer demand.
- Prepare lease-up plan in parallel with completion schedule.
